C语言里,什么是整形变量和复合变量?int和double的区别

来源:百度知道 编辑:UC知道 时间:2024/05/19 09:32:43
偶素小白~~

整形—— int型
复合—— 你可以理解为包含很多小成员的一个整体结构。

int与double 区别:

你可以理解为int不带小数点 double带小数点

其实他们都是数据的表示和存储方式的不同。为了满足各种不同需求而产生的。

整形变量就是int类型的
复合变量就是像结构,共用体之类的数据类型

double是双精度浮点型

复合变量是指结构体等,复合变量其中可以有其他的变量,如整型,实型等!

整型变量int是指变量的值只能是整数可以是-1,0,1等等整数!

而double是双精度浮点数,也就是可以带小数的,比如2.13等等,他和float的区别是,他可以表示小数的范围更大!

好久没用C了,回答不是很详细!
祝你学习顺利!

整形变量就是int类型的
复合变量就是像结构,共用体之类的数据类型
int 变量只能放整数(占4字节)
double 放的是双精度型数据(占8字节)